Travel Score in 41149, Isonville, Kentucky

The Travel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 41149, Isonville, Kentucky is 15 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

57.89 percent of residents in 41149 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 19.61 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Morgan County Arh Hospital with a distance of 14.92 miles from the area.

## Prostate Cancer Score: Navigating Healthcare in Isonville (ZIP Code 41149)

The tranquility of Isonville, Kentucky (ZIP Code 41149), a community nestled in the Appalachian foothills, offers a respite from the frenetic pace of city life. However, the serene landscape presents unique challenges when it comes to healthcare access, particularly for those facing a prostate cancer diagnosis. This write-up explores the realities of navigating the healthcare system in this area, focusing on transportation options and their impact on a patient’s Prostate Cancer Score. The score, in this context, reflects the ease and efficiency with which a patient can access necessary medical services, from initial diagnosis to ongoing treatment and follow-up care.

The first hurdle is geographical. Isonville is a rural community, and the nearest comprehensive medical facilities are located in larger towns and cities. This translates directly into travel time, a significant factor in our Prostate Cancer Score. Consider the initial diagnostic phase, often involving a prostate-specific antigen (PSA) test, digital rectal exam, and potentially a biopsy. These procedures might be available at the smaller, local clinics, but specialized imaging (MRI, CT scans) and consultations with a urologist or oncologist often necessitate a journey.

The primary artery connecting Isonville to the outside world is **Kentucky Route 321**. This winding road, while scenic, is not designed for speed. Reaching the nearest major medical center in Ashland, Kentucky, a journey of approximately 30 miles, can take anywhere from 45 minutes to an hour by car, depending on traffic and road conditions. This drive time becomes a critical component of the Prostate Cancer Score, particularly when factoring in potential fatigue, post-procedure discomfort, and the emotional toll of a cancer diagnosis.

The **Mountain Parkway**, though accessible via secondary routes, offers a faster alternative for those heading further afield, such as Lexington or Huntington, West Virginia. However, the commute time significantly increases. Lexington, home to the University of Kentucky’s Markey Cancer Center, is roughly a two-hour drive via the Mountain Parkway and **Interstate 64**. Huntington, with its Marshall University Medical Center, is a similar distance, requiring travel on **US Route 60** and **Interstate 64**. These longer commutes directly impact the Prostate Cancer Score, potentially delaying treatment and increasing patient stress.

Public transportation options in Isonville are limited. There is no established bus route that directly serves the area. This lack of public transit significantly diminishes the Prostate Cancer Score for individuals without personal vehicles or those unable to drive. The absence of accessible public transportation disproportionately affects elderly patients, those with mobility issues, and those with limited financial resources.

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, are available in the region, but their presence is often sporadic, particularly in rural areas like Isonville. Availability may be limited, and surge pricing during peak hours or inclement weather could significantly increase the cost of transportation. The reliability of ride-sharing, therefore, is not a dependable factor in the Prostate Cancer Score.

Medical transportation services, specifically designed to transport patients to and from medical appointments, offer a more specialized solution. Several companies operate in the region, including First Transit and American Medical Response (AMR). These services typically provide door-to-door transportation, including assistance with mobility and wheelchair accessibility. However, their availability and cost vary. The Prostate Cancer Score benefits from these services, but it is crucial to assess the accessibility, affordability, and responsiveness of these providers.

The ADA (Americans with Disabilities Act) compliance of any available transportation is a critical consideration. Patients with mobility limitations need assurance that vehicles are equipped with ramps or lifts and that drivers are trained to assist. This factor directly influences the Prostate Cancer Score, ensuring equitable access to care for all patients, regardless of their physical abilities.

The financial burden of transportation adds another layer of complexity to the Prostate Cancer Score. Gas prices, vehicle maintenance, and the cost of ride-sharing or medical transportation services can quickly accumulate, potentially creating a barrier to care. Patients on fixed incomes or with limited insurance coverage may struggle to afford the necessary transportation, which can lead to missed appointments, delayed treatment, and ultimately, a poorer prognosis.
